**Alert: TaxRateCacheStale.** The Fennel tax-rate lookup cache in the Quillbill service has not refreshed in over 6 hours. Checkout falls back to last-known rates, which risks incorrect totals for jurisdictions updated this week. Hold the release until the refresher job recovers. Triage steps and cache invalidation commands are documented on the page below.

wiki page, hahif-hahif: https://argocd.kelvisys.corp/browse/board/settings/pages/1442e0b1065d83f1

Key Ceremony Checklist — Item 7: Bloom Filter Seed Verification. Before sealing the Orvane key-value store, confirm that the front-line bloom filter has been rebuilt from the post-ceremony key set, and that its false-positive rate is logged at or below 0.1%. The release manager witnesses the rebuild and countersigns the ledger. To authorize the final seal, the release manager enters the ceremony recovery passphrase recorded below.

recovery phrase for fajep-yaweg: gilath-sorox-wenius-rusdor-keliel-zorius

Effective the first of next month, we switch logistics providers from Hathwick Transport to Norgren Carriers. All outbound shipments route through the Calverstone hub. Update dispatch documentation, retrain loading staff on Norgren manifests, and return Hathwick scanning equipment by the fifteenth. Expect two weeks of dual-running; flag exceptions to regional ops daily. Delivery windows tighten to 48 hours for priority stock. No customer-facing changes are to be announced. Strategic context is appended confidentially below.

board note of bawep-tajef: Queniusek Systems plans to raise the Quenvan list price by 53.1 percent in March. The pricing group signed off on a budget of $176.4 million for Project Drueth. The renewal with Casionix Partners closes at $142.5 million a year, 8.3 percent below the last contract. Project Fraax slips by six weeks because of the tooling delay.